New offer - be the first one to apply!

June 18, 2026

JavaScript (React, Typescript)/ Mashup Developer

Senior • Hybrid

Krakow, Poland

For our Client, we are looking for an experienced JavaScript (React, Typescript) / Mashup Developer.

Location: Kraków – hybrid work model (2 days per week in the office, 3 days remote)
Cooperation model: Full-time / B2B
Project: Financial sector

Requirements

  • 10+ years of experience on ReactJs 16.x or above
  • Hands-on experience using AI tools (e.g. GitHub CoPilot, Claude) for development work
  • Strong experience with TypeScript and ES6
  • Strong experience with D3.js
  • Strong experience with AG-Grid library
  • Strong knowledge of React Hooks and React Redux (including middleware like thunk)
  • Excellent knowledge of HTML5, CSS3, Bootstrap, including Media Queries
  • Experience with Material-UI or other React-specific UI libraries
  • Strong understanding of Enigma.js
  • Strong understanding of WebSockets
  • Strong understanding of integrating QlikSense API with React layer
  • Experience with Qlik API integration
  • Experience in unit testing using Jest and Enzyme
  • Ability to build generic UI components
  • Experience with Module Federation using Webpack
  • Strong experience with Axios and fetch-like libraries for API calls
  • Experience using Jira, Jenkins, Ansible for automated deployments
  • Experience with GitHub or other source control and release software
  • Experience in identifying and fixing security vulnerabilities in code
  • Knowledge of MI reporting platforms
  • Fluency in English (spoken and written)

Benefits

  • Private medical care (Luxmed)
  • Multisport card
  • Collaborative team culture and modern tech stack